Verve Coffee Roasters Streetlevel Blend is a premium, hand-roasted instant coffee crafted from ethically sourced beans across Central America. This certified organic medium French roast delivers a balanced flavor profile with citrus and honeycomb notes, offering up to 6 servings per packet. Designed for busy professionals, it brews perfectly hot or cold, preserving small-batch freshness in a convenient, pocket-ready format.

Expensive but tasty
Tastes great for instant. I dissolve my instant coffee in a bit of cold water and then add the boiling to prevent it burning. Packet dissolved easily in just 2oz of cold water. It is unpleasantly strong in just 10oz of water as recommended. I find it much better in 20oz of water, makes it last longer also. Threw a couple packs in the glove box and a few in the backpack, I'm interested to find out how they hold up to temperature changes over time. Took a star off for the price, not sure I'll buy again unless is becomes cheaper.

Surprised at the quality!
It is only a point or two below fresh french press gourmet coffee I make at home. It may be pricey, but I don't expect to be making instant everyday, so the extra price is worth the quality. Note: the 10oz recommended water amount seems like a lot for the amount of coffee in the packet, but it is really well balanced at that amount. I would suggest starting with 90-100F water at 2oz to dissolve and followed with 8 oz of 140-160F to heat. Overall, great coffee! :D
